To use Doc Hub, first upload a PDF to Google Drive and open it. Click "Open With" to see apps connected to the file. If Doc Hub is not connected, click "Connect More Apps" and search for Doc Hub to connect it. Once connected, a notification will appear to confirm. Click "Open With" to access Doc Hub for the specific file.
